Lee DeForest of New City, NY died on Friday October 31st, 2025 in Mahwah, NJ. Lee was born June 17th, 1964, in Suffern, NY and was raised in New City, NY.
Lee is predeceased by his parents, Raymond and Alice DeForest, of New City, NY; his sister, Cheryl Sites, of Harrisburg, PA, and his brother William DeForest of Falls Church, VA.
Lee is survived by his brother Raymond DeForest and his sisters Cynthia Morehead, Lynne DeForest, (Debra) and Mary Maloney (James), as well as many nieces, nephews and cousins.
Lee graduated from Clarkstown South High School, in West Nyack, NY in 1982 and then attended Rockland Community College, where he received his associates degree. Lee went on to work for the Town of Clarkstown, which he retired from in 2012.
Lee was an avid outdoorsman, who loved camping, fishing, and white-water rafting. He took great pride in completing a skydiving jump in 1988. In his spare time, he enjoyed sports, and for many years played in both softball and bowling leagues, as well as the occasional round of golf. He loved watching the NY Mets and Jets and was a loyal fan through their ups and downs.
Lee was a quiet, unassuming man, with a quick wit, who enjoyed spending time with his family and their family dogs. He took great delight in working a crossword puzzle to completion and playing chess with his brothers.
